Job Title: QA Sales Executive Professional Testing Services with SaaS

Location: Seeking candidates local to NY/NJ or East Coast

Roles and Responsibilities:
  • Own and deliver revenue targets across assigned enterprise accounts or regions.

  • Drive new business development by identifying and converting opportunities through cold calling, referrals, events, digital outreach, social selling, and networking.

  • Collaborate with internal presales, solution architects, and delivery teams to craft tailored service proposals, RFP responses, and client presentations.

  • Conduct service capability presentations and articulate the value of testing services in reducing business risk, improving time-to-market, and achieving digital transformation goals.

  • Build and maintain long-term client relationships, ensuring customer satisfaction and account growth.

  • Manage the complete sales cycle: from lead generation and qualification to proposal, negotiation, and closure.

  • Work closely with marketing and demand generation teams to increase visibility and lead flow for testing services.

Candidate Profile Experience and Desired Competencies:
  • 10 15 years of enterprise IT services sales experience, with a strong track record in selling QA/Testing Services.

  • Minimum 3 years of direct experience in selling professional or managed testing services, including automation, performance, or test consulting.

  • Sound understanding of the software testing lifecycle, QA challenges in digital transformation, and trends in automation and AI-led testing.

  • Proven success in engaging with CXOs, QA Heads, CIOs, and other key decision-makers.

  • Ability to independently own sales cycles and collaborate cross-functionally for proposal creation and solutioning.

  • Strong business acumen with excellent communication, negotiation, and presentation skills.

  • Familiarity with CRM platforms and experience in sales reporting and forecasting.

  • High energy, self-motivated, proactive, and goal-oriented.

  • A team player who thrives in a fast-paced, customer-centric environment.
